India's Foreign Secretary Vikram Misri is heading to Europe for critical diplomatic talks on energy, defence, and trade amid escalating West Asia tensions. The three-day visit to Paris and Berlin follows his meetings with Trump administration officials in the US. Energy security concerns stemming from regional instability will dominate discussions with French and German counterparts. India aims to strengthen bilateral cooperation across defence, civil nuclear energy, technology, and green energy initiatives. These talks underscore India's strategic pivot toward deepening ties with major European powers during a period of significant geopolitical uncertainty and shifting global trade dynamics.
